Early day motion tabled by primary sponsor Marquess of Lothian (Conservative), on Tuesday, 10 February 2004, in the House of Commons. It is signed by 48 members in total.
TERRORIST BOMBINGS IN ARBIL
That this House recalls the horrific suicide bombing of the offices of the Kurdish PUK and KDP parties in Arbil in northern Iraq on 1st February; unreservedly condemns this act of terrorism; expresses its sympathies and condolences to the victims and relatives of victims of the attack; and calls upon all people in Iraq to work together with each other, the UN, other countries and non-governmental organisations to build a prosperous and peaceful future for their country.
